Virtual Breadboard features and specs

  • Cost-effective
    Virtual Breadboard allows users to simulate circuits without needing to purchase physical components, reducing costs associated with hardware procurement.
  • Accessibility
    Being a software-based tool, it can be accessed and used from anywhere, as long as there is a computer with the software installed.
  • Educational Use
    The platform is ideal for educational purposes, enabling students to experiment and learn about electronics without requiring physical components.
  • Error Reduction
    By simulating circuits, users can catch and correct errors in design before building the actual hardware, reducing the likelihood of mistakes.
  • Convenience
    Users can quickly make changes and test different configurations without the hassle of physical rewiring.

Possible disadvantages of Virtual Breadboard

  • Limited Realism
    While good for simulation, virtual environments may not perfectly replicate how circuits behave in the real world due to factors like noise and material imperfections.
  • Learning Curve
    New users might find it challenging to learn how to use the software efficiently, particularly if they are not familiar with circuit design.
  • Hardware Limitations
    The simulator might not support all available components or complex circuits, which could be a limitation for advanced users.
  • Dependence on Technology
    Virtual Breadboard requires a working computer and software setup, which might be a constraint where technological resources are limited.
  • Lack of Tactile Feedback
    Unlike physical breadboards, users do not gain hands-on experience, which is particularly valuable for those learning circuit design.
